NTSB Accident & Incident Record

Oct 10, 2006 Accident Substantial Chugiak, AK
InjuriesNone
Phase of Flight-
ConditionsVMC
OperationFAR 091
Probable Cause

The pilot's failure to maintain control of the glider while landing in gusty crosswind conditions, which resulted in a hard landing and structural damage to the fuselage. Factors associated with the accident were turbulence, a crosswind and wind gusts, and the pilot's inadequate evaluation of the weather conditions.

NTSB ANC07CA005
